Contributions from SUSY-FCNC couplings to the interpretation of the HyperCP events for the decay Σ^+ \to p μ^+ μ^-
Abstract
The observation of three events for the decay $Σ^+ \to p μ^+ μ^-$ with a dimuon invariant mass of $214.3\pm0.5$MeV by the HyperCP collaboration imply that a new particle X may be needed to explain the observed dimuon invariant mass distribution. We show that there are regions in the SUSY-FCNC parameter space where the $A^0_1$ in the NMSSM can be used to explain the HyperCP events without contradicting all the existing constraints from the measurements of the kaon decays, and the constraints from the $K^0-\bar{K}^0$ mixing are automatically satisfied once the constraints from kaon decays are satisfied.
